#b09399 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b09399 is composed of 69% red, 57.6% green and 60%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 16.5% magenta, 13.1%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 347.6 degrees, a saturation of 15.5% and a lightness of 63.3%. #b09399 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#612733. Closest websafe color is: #999999.

● #b09399 color description : Dark grayish red.
#b09399 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b09399 has RGB values of R:176, G:147, B:153 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.16, Y:0.13,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 11572121.
